This Six Sigma Green Belt: Roles & Benefits
A Process Improvement Green Belt plays a critical part within an business striving for sustained improvement . Their primary responsibility involves assisting improvement champions and senior team members to deploy Lean practices. Green Belts typically manage smaller process initiatives and actively participate in statistical evaluation to uncover key drivers of inefficiencies . They are required to apply data-driven approaches like control charts and value stream mapping to design efficient solutions .
Here's a concise summary of standard Green Belt duties :
- Engage in process scope and establishment.
- Collect and review information .
- Illustrate workflows using visual tools .
- Determine possibilities for improvement .
- Deploy Lean interventions.
- Track performance and communicate outcomes .

Understanding the Lean Six Sigma Green Belt
A Green Belt in Lean Six Sigma Improvement represents a significant step up from the Yellow Belt. These individuals have obtained training in applying Lean and Six Sigma tools to address challenges within an business. They work with project teams to pinpoint and reduce waste and errors in operations. Typical Green Belt initiatives often involve smaller, more specific improvement efforts, and a Green Belt can lead multiple such initiatives concurrently.
- Focuses on process optimization
- Applies statistical data
- Contributes to a culture of constant progression
